60th Anniversary
Today was my parents 60th Wedding Anniversary. It was a bittersweet day because they are not with us. The last anniversary they celebrated was 2 years ago. They had 58 wonderful years together. They had a deep love that you don't find as often today. They built a business together, raised 5 children, and were able to retire soon enough to travel and spend time with relatives and friends. I think back to all the wonderful memories and the celebrations we had. They had 14 grandchildren and 5 great-grandchildren, with 1 more added earlier this year. So remember to count your blessings and celebrate all the wonderful memories you hold so dear in your heart.
You never know how much longer you have with your loved ones. I miss them more and more each day. I think of something I want to tell them about what happened today, or who I taked to or something about the new baby and then remember... I can't do that. But I think they are looking down on us and taking care of us still, as they did when we were children. Happy Anniversary..........this year you can celebrate together again.

Downey quilt

This is one of the Downey quilts that I have finished. I love the stripe binding.

When I started this quilt I couldn't find where I set the pattern, so I just made up a pattern as I went. My only problem was that there wasn't enough of the main fabric so one of the squares ended up as a 4 patch. Otherwise I think it turned out good. I'm working on another one before I send this back, might as well send both at the same time.
